Antique jewelry object group: pendants
Country of origin: Although there are no hallmarks indicating the country of origin, we believe this to be German or Austrian by its design.
Style: Art Nouveau

Style specifics: The floral ornaments and botanical designs are very typical for the Art Nouveau style. Also the use of curvilinear lines is typical for this period.
Period: ca. 1890

Material: 18K yellow gold

Diamonds:
Ten old mine brilliant cut diamonds with
a total estimated weight of approx. 0.22 crt.
Note: All diamond weights, color grades and clarity are approximate since the stones were not removed from their mounts to preserve the integrity of the setting.
